The 2006 Chairman's Club Syrah/Carignan is a 50/50 blend of Syrah and Carignan from two polar opposites in viticulture. A field mixture of clones 174, 383 & 525 planted three years ago, the Syrah resides on a south-facing hillside. Aromas of blackberries, white pepper, barrel spice and tar expolode from the glass and the palate delivers a delicious mouthfeel of fruit and balanced tannin, with juicy black berries, eucalyptus and lavender.
